Are you looking for the top Point Guard designs to play in NBA 2K23? The Point Guard, also called The One or The Point typically MT 2K23 is the most diminutive player in an NBA team. They run the offense in a manner similar to quarterbacks within the NFL. If you're in this position the role you play is to assist teammates and finishing offensive plays.
The latest-gen Point Guard build is a shooter and playmaker god, with decent defense around the perimeter and a huge badge potential. The build is able to reach an OVR of 99 and is upgradeable to 70 Badge Points, which include: 18 finishing Badge Points and 24 Shooting Badges 22 , Playmaking Badge Points and 6 Defense/Rebounding Badge Points.
The latest-gen Point Guard build is a pure shooting and playmaking monster that has just enough defense to finish the job at the perimeter. The build is able to reach an OVR of 99 and is upgradeable to the 83 Badge Points, which include: 15 finishing Badge Points and 26 Shooting Badges, 29 playmaking Badge Points and 13 Defense/Rebounding Badge Points.
